Bijar rugs originate from the Kurdish region of northwest Persia and are highly admired for their dense weave, durability, and powerful craftsmanship. Often known as the “Iron Rugs of Persia,” Bijar carpets are valued for their firm construction and ability to last for generations. How do I care for a hand-knotted rug?
Vacuum regularly without a beater bar, rotate the rug once or twice a year so it wears evenly, and blot spills immediately rather than rubbing them. We offer professional cleaning and restoration in-house whenever it needs more than that.
